Wheaton College (Ill.) Jack Guenther named the CCIW Men's Tennis Player of the Week

Thunder senior Jack Guenther was selected as the College Conference of Illinois & Wisconsin (CCIW) Men's Tennis Player of the Week by the conference office.

Guenther was 3-0 in singles competition last week and teamed with Panjwani for a 3-0 record at No. 3 doubles. He defeated North Central's Lucas Pindak 6-2, 6-2 on April 23, earned a win against Augustana's Leonardo Panosso 6-2, 6-3 on April 24, and was victorious against Millikin's Nick Laramee 6-2, 6-4 on April 27. Guenther and Panjwani defeated North Central's Justin Howes and Pindak 8-4, picked up a win against Augustana's Jack Morkin and Caio DeRezende 8-3, and were winners against the Millikin tandem of Laramee and Holden Owens 8-4.

Wheaton College sponsors 21 varsity sports, and Thunder teams compete at the NCAA Division III level. The Thunder Athletics program has won five NCAA Division III Championships since 1984, and Wheaton student-athletes have won 31 Division III individual National Championships all-time.
